Phase 2E of Epic #11624 (Cloud-Native KB Ingestion). Adds tenant ingestion-config storage: a per-tenant KnowledgeBaseTenantConfig node in the Native Edge Graph, resolved via a new KnowledgeBaseIngestionService.getTenantConfig (three-tier — graph node → kb-config.yaml deployment bootstrap → default registry) and mutated via setTenantConfig (versioned, RLS-gated). Every ingested chunk is stamped with the active tenantConfigVersion, so a future config change can drive retroactive invalidation.

What shipped

  • GraphService.getNodeRecord({id}) (ai/services/memory-core/) — a properties-returning, RLS-checked node getter. getNode projects only the hoisted fields and strips the properties blob; the tenant config payload lives in properties, so the new getter applies the identical #10011 RLS re-check (a cross-tenant node returns null) and returns {id, type, properties}.
  • KnowledgeBaseIngestionService.getTenantConfig({tenantId}) — three-tier resolution: the kb-config:<tenantId> graph node → the kb-config.yaml deployment bootstrap ({tenants: {<id>: {...}}}, fail-soft via js-yaml) → the default source/parser registry.
  • KnowledgeBaseIngestionService.setTenantConfig({tenantId, config}) — writes the versioned KnowledgeBaseTenantConfig node; version increments per mutation. RLS-gated via resolveTenantContext (a cross-tenant write is rejected with KB_INGEST_TENANT_MISMATCH).
  • tenantConfigVersion chunk-metadata stampingestSourceFiles resolves the active version and threads it through tenantContext; VectorService.resolveTenantStamp adds it to the authoritative tenant stamp (and TENANT_GUARDED_FIELDS guards it server-side).

Deltas from ticket

Substrate-grounded design decisions, documented on the #11637 Contract Ledger:

  • D1 — tenant config entries are a properties JSON payload, not SourceRegistration/ParserRegistration edge-nodes (the ticket Fix's literal wording). V-B-A found the #11658 Source Registry is class-Map-based — minting registration graph-nodes would be a substrate expansion past Q5's scope. The ticket goal (graph-stored, tenant-scoped, versioned config) is unchanged.
  • D2 — added GraphService.getNodeRecord because getNode/searchNodes strip the properties blob; a raw db.nodes.get would bypass the #10011 RLS re-check.
  • setTenantConfig RLSGraphService.upsertNode auto-stamps the caller's identity onto properties.userId, so an un-gated cross-tenant write would silently re-own the node rather than be rejected; setTenantConfig therefore gates explicitly on resolveTenantContext.
  • Ownership primitive — properties.userId, not an OWNED_BY edge. The Contract Ledger's KnowledgeBaseTenantConfig matrix row listed one OWNED_BY edge → AgentIdentity; Phase 2E instead uses properties.userId (auto-stamped by upsertNode) as the sole ownership mechanism — #10011 isRlsVisible gates on properties.userId, so an OWNED_BY edge would be a redundant second representation (the same substrate-expansion logic as D1). The ledger row is corrected in #11637 comment 4503692675; surfaced by @neo-gpt's Cycle-1 review.
  • Graph-as-ingestion-dependency — routing getTenantConfig into ingestSourceFiles makes the Native Edge Graph a dependency of the ingestion path; the call is fail-soft (graph-unavailable → tenantConfigVersion: 0, the ingest still completes).
  • kb-config.yaml naming#11700's per-workspace fixture kb-config.yaml files are a distinct artifact (per-synthetic-workspace test descriptors) from this PR's deployment-root server-config; no path collision, the name overlap is benign for V1.

Thanks @neo-gpt — accurate catch. The Contract Ledger Matrix row for KnowledgeBaseTenantConfig did promise an OWNED_BY edge the implementation never wrote; that is a real contract-drift artifact and worth fixing pre-merge.

Resolution — option (b): the ledger row over-specified; the implementation is correct. Phase 2E intentionally uses properties.userId (auto-stamped by upsertNode) as the sole ownership primitive, not an OWNED_BY graph edge:

  • #10011 isRlsVisible — the gate getNode / getNodeRecord apply — resolves ownership from properties.userId. An OWNED_BY edge is not read by the RLS gate; it would be decorative.
  • A parallel edge is a redundant second source of truth for ownership — drift-prone, and the same substrate expansion D1 rejected.
  • The ledger comment's own prose ("upsertNode auto-stamps properties.userId … cross-tenant mutation blocked at the substrate") already described the correct design; only the Matrix row's OWNED_BY clause was inconsistent with it.
